This trail branches off the Middle (XC) Trail and ascends to its junction with the XC Cut-Off (on the left). The trail continues through a boulder field and ascends and descends over some minor humps. The trail continues to climb to its junction with the Watkin's Way (XC) Trail (on left). A little ways past this junction, the trail reaches the summit of Bickford Heights (1,080 ft.) Here at the summit is the border of the Bolles Reserve and the Clark Reserve. From here, the trail descends the west side of the hill over steep rock. Watch your step when ice is present. The trail descends, following faded white dots or squares, to an old logging road. The trail is difficult to follow through here; pay close attention to the blazes. Shortly after the logging road, the trail passes through the outskirts of a very small pond. And, if you are able to navigate your way through this area, you should arrive at the trail's end at Old Mail (XC) Road.
